What is a QC Lab Chemist?

QC Lab Chemists, or Quality Control Laboratory Chemists, are professionals responsible for testing and analyzing materials and products to ensure they meet established quality standards and specifications. They use various laboratory techniques and instruments to examine chemical composition, purity, and stability of samples. Their work is crucial for industries such as pharmaceuticals, food and beverage, and manufacturing to ensure products are safe and compliant with regulatory requirements. QC Lab Chemists also document their findings and may help troubleshoot issues in production processes.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a QC Lab Chemist, and why are they important?

To thrive as a QC Lab Chemist, you need a solid background in chemistry or related sciences, typically with a bachelor's degree and experience in laboratory testing and analysis. Familiarity with analytical instruments such as HPLC, GC, FTIR, and proficiency in using laboratory information management systems (LIMS) are essential, along with relevant certifications like Good Laboratory Practice (GLP). Attention to detail, problem-solving ability, and effective communication skills help ensure accurate results and effective teamwork. These skills and qualifications are critical for maintaining product quality, regulatory compliance, and the overall success of laboratory operations.

What are some common challenges a QC Lab Chemist may face when ensuring product quality, and how are they typically addressed?

QC Lab Chemists often encounter challenges such as maintaining strict adherence to testing protocols, troubleshooting unexpected results, and managing tight deadlines to meet production schedules. Addressing these issues usually involves thorough documentation, regular calibration of instruments, and effective communication with production and R&D teams. Staying up to date with industry regulations and participating in ongoing training also help QC Lab Chemists maintain high standards and resolve issues efficiently.

What is the difference between Qc Lab Chemist vs Quality Control Technician?

AspectQc Lab ChemistQuality Control Technician
CredentialsBachelor's degree in Chemistry or related field, certifications often preferredHigh school diploma or associate degree, certifications optional
Work EnvironmentLaboratory setting, performing testing and analysisLaboratory or production environment, monitoring quality
Job ResponsibilitiesDesigning tests, analyzing data, ensuring product qualityConducting routine tests, recording results, maintaining equipment

The main difference is that Qc Lab Chemists typically have a higher level of education and are involved in designing and analyzing tests, while Quality Control Technicians focus on routine testing and monitoring product quality. Both roles are essential in quality assurance within manufacturing and laboratory settings.

What does a QC Lab Chemist do?

A QC Lab Chemist conducts tests and analyses on raw materials, in-process samples, and finished products to ensure they meet quality standards and specifications. They use laboratory equipment, follow standard operating procedures, and often require knowledge of safety protocols and quality management systems. Their work helps maintain product consistency and compliance with regulatory requirements.

Job Summary (Basic Functions): LG Chem Advanced Materials, Inc. (LGCTA) is actively searching for QC Lab Technicians to join our Quality Control team in Clarksville, TN. QC Lab Technicians will be responsible for supporting mass production quality by performing laboratory testing, operating analytical instruments, and assisting with overall QC inspection tasks.
There are two levels of responsibility within this role: Shift Leader and Technician/Inspector. Both roles are part of a rotating shift schedule to provide 24/7 quality support.
This position is based full-time in Clarksville, TN and is not a remote role.
What You will Be Doing
Essential Functions (including but are not limited to):
Shift Leader Responsibilities:
  • Supervise QC inspectors in the assigned shift and manage attendance/shift operations.
  • Possess overall understanding of all analytical tests performed in the QC Lab (pH, Moisture, Air Jet Sieve, H-XRF, SEM, PSD, ICP-OES, XRD, P-XRF, BET, Tap Density, Coin Cell, etc.)
  • Provide technical support and backup assistance to inspectors when needed, ensuring continuity of lab operations.
  • Conduct regular inspection and basic maintenance of lab utilities and analytical instruments.
  • Prepare and maintain laboratory safety and environmental compliance documents.
  • Responsible for the ordering, receiving, and inventory control of laboratory consumables.
  • Perform quality checks for packaging materials.
  • Receive incoming samples, prioritize, and schedule analysis tasks.
  • Handle preparation and shipment of advanced customer samples (e.g., portioning into aluminum pouches and boxing).
  • Act as first escalation point for abnormal data, equipment issues, or safety concerns before reporting to QC Engineers.
  • Input and maintain analysis data in designated systems with high accuracy.
  • Conduct safety talk.
  • Perform job duties in accordance with LG Chem safety policies.

Technician / Inspector Responsibilities:
  • Conduct chemical, physical, and Electrochemical Characterization of the materials using different analytical techniques such as :
    pH Titrator, Moisture Analyzer, Air Jet Sieve, H-XRF, Auto-SEM, PSD Analyzer, ICP-OES, XRD, P-XRF, BET Analyzer, Tap Density Analyzer, Coin Cell Assembly & Test, etc. in accordance to SOPs.

* Analytical tasks will be assigned based on individual qualification and competency assessments.(Not every technician will operate all instruments; responsibilities will be distributed according to training completion and certification level.)
  • Conduct regular inspection and basic maintenance of analytical instruments.
  • Dispose of analyzed samples and related materials according to safety guidelines.
  • Act as first escalation point for abnormal data, equipment issues, or safety concerns before reporting to QC Engineers.
  • Assist with the review of laboratory safety and environmental compliance documents.
  • Assist with the ordering, receiving, and inventory control of laboratory consumables.
  • Perform routine lab maintenance for e.g., replace and monitor lab filters (air, water, gas) as required.
  • Inspect packaging materials (bags, ton-bags) for compliance with quality standards.
  • Receive incoming samples, prioritize, and schedule analysis tasks.
  • Handle preparation and shipment of advanced customer samples (e.g., portioning into aluminum pouches and boxing).
  • Input and maintain analysis data in designated systems with high accuracy.
  • Perform job duties in accordance with LG Chem safety policies.
